Loft Painting in Wilmington, NC
Loft pain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int to the uppermost spaces of a home, including attics, vaulted ceilings, and other elevated areas. These projects typically include preparing surfaces, selecting appropriate finishes, and ensuring a smooth, even application of paint. Homeowners often request loft painting to update the appearance of their living spaces, improve lighting by brightening ceilings, or enhance the overall aesthetic of their property’s interior.
Before requesting loft painting services, property owners usually want to understand the condition of the existing surfaces, including any repairs needed prior to painting. They may also inquire about suitable paint types for high or hard-to-reach areas, and whether the work will be completed with minimal disruption to daily routines. Clarifying the scope of the project and any necessary preparations helps ensure the finished result meets expectations.

Common Loft Painting Jobs
Attic ceiling painting - enhances the appearance and brightness of attic spaces.
Vapor barrier painting - helps control moisture and improves attic insulation performance.
Insulation sealing - involves painting or coating to improve energy efficiency in the attic.
Attic hatch and access door painting - provides a finished look and protects surfaces from wear.
Structural beam and joist painting - offers a clean, uniform appearance for exposed attic framing.
Attic ventilation system painting - maintains airflow components and prevents deterioration.
Loft Painting Questions
What types of loft painting projects are common? Typical projects include repainting attic spaces, converting lofts into living areas, and updating ceilings and walls for aesthetic or maintenance reasons.
Is special preparation needed before loft painting? Yes, surfaces should be cleaned and any repairs or sanding completed to ensure proper paint adhesion and a smooth finish.
What finishes are suitable for loft painting? Flat, matte, satin, and semi-gloss finishes are commonly used depending on the desired look and durability requirements.
How can property owners ensure a quality loft paint job? Proper surface preparation, selecting appropriate paint types, and hiring experienced painters help achieve a long-lasting, professional result.
